diff options
author | eugeni <eugeni@b3059339-0415-0410-9bf9-f77b7e298cf2> | 2006-09-16 13:32:46 +0000 |
---|---|---|
committer | eugeni <eugeni@b3059339-0415-0410-9bf9-f77b7e298cf2> | 2006-09-16 13:32:46 +0000 |
commit | 69cbeae8457acc1266d5471c5b7b9fb4dff2d374 (patch) | |
tree | 32732bb00905d13ac0ae90a04155af5cb4c73f2e /libass/ass_bitmap.h | |
parent | b21382fa5b313ab1faa6a7722e77bf3b56f3be2f (diff) | |
download | mpv-69cbeae8457acc1266d5471c5b7b9fb4dff2d374.tar.bz2 mpv-69cbeae8457acc1266d5471c5b7b9fb4dff2d374.tar.xz |
Add \be (blur edges) support to libass.
git-svn-id: svn://svn.mplayerhq.hu/mplayer/trunk@19854 b3059339-0415-0410-9bf9-f77b7e298cf2
Diffstat (limited to 'libass/ass_bitmap.h')
-rw-r--r-- | libass/ass_bitmap.h | 7 |
1 files changed, 6 insertions, 1 deletions
diff --git a/libass/ass_bitmap.h b/libass/ass_bitmap.h index edf4790584..7a6d7d459f 100644 --- a/libass/ass_bitmap.h +++ b/libass/ass_bitmap.h @@ -1,13 +1,18 @@ #ifndef __ASS_BITMAP_H__ #define __ASS_BITMAP_H__ +typedef struct ass_synth_priv_s ass_synth_priv_t; + +ass_synth_priv_t* ass_synth_init(); +void ass_synth_done(ass_synth_priv_t* priv); + typedef struct bitmap_s { int left, top; int w, h; // width, height unsigned char* buffer; // w x h buffer } bitmap_t; -int glyph_to_bitmap(FT_Glyph glyph, FT_Glyph outline_glyph, bitmap_t** bm_g, bitmap_t** bm_o); +int glyph_to_bitmap(ass_synth_priv_t* priv, FT_Glyph glyph, FT_Glyph outline_glyph, bitmap_t** bm_g, bitmap_t** bm_o, int be); void ass_free_bitmap(bitmap_t* bm); #endif |